Based on comparable computer engineering technology programs nationwide, New England Institute of Technology's associate degree appears to offer a reasonable path into technical work, with estimated first-year earnings around $43,000 and projected debt of roughly $13,000. That 0.30 debt-to-earnings ratio sits comfortably below the concerning 1.0 threshold, suggesting graduates could feasibly manage their loans even if starting salaries come in lower than the national typical figure. With nearly half of students receiving Pell grants, this program seems designed to provide accessible technical training without burying students in debt.
The challenge is that we're working entirely from national peer program data—both the earnings and debt figures are estimates because this specific program's graduate cohort was too small for the Department of Education to report. While the national median for computer engineering technology programs provides some guidance, Rhode Island's tech market and New England Institute's particular employer connections could produce substantially different outcomes. The state has just two schools offering this credential, making local benchmarking impossible.
For families weighing this investment, the estimated numbers suggest manageable financial risk if the program delivers on its promise of technical skills employers actually need. Visit the campus, talk to recent graduates if possible, and ask pointed questions about job placement rates and typical starting positions. The theoretical math works, but you'll need to verify whether this particular program connects students to Rhode Island's technology sector effectively.

About This Data
Source: U.S. Department of Education College Scorecard (October 2025 release)
Population: Graduates who received federal financial aid (Title IV grants or loans). At New England Institute of Technology, approximately 44% of students receive Pell grants. Students who did not receive federal aid are not included in these figures.
Earnings: Median earnings from IRS W-2 data for graduates who are employed and not enrolled in further education, measured 1 year after completion. Earnings are pre-tax and include wages, salaries, and self-employment income.
Debt: Median cumulative federal loan debt at graduation. Does not include private loans or Parent PLUS loans borrowed on behalf of students.
Estimated Earnings: Actual earnings data is not available for this program (typically due to privacy thresholds when fewer than 30 graduates reported earnings). The estimate shown is based on the national median of 12 similar programs. Actual outcomes may vary.
